About the role:

MPK is seeking an experienced HSE Manager to join our Project team, reporting through to the Project Manager.

Initially based in the Brisbane support office, Monday to Friday before transitioning to a site based role on a 10:4 roster.


Key responsibilities:

  • Lead and manage the project HSE team including implementation of work schedules for areas of responsibility, assigning, and communicating priorities.
  • Recognise and manage development/training needs within the HSE team and communicate these through the MPK's Personal and Professional Development processes.
  • Able to interpret Health, Safety and Environmental legislation, monitor and report on compliance.
  • Implement a certified HSE Management system, in line with corporate standards and procedures that reflects best practice and that is aligned with all relevant legislation, contract and certification requirements.
  • Develop and maintain Project specific HSE management plans in consultation with all stakeholders and are communicated appropriately.
  • Facilitate the Project HAZID and develop the Project Risk Register, identifying hazards associated with the scope of works ensuring that appropriate controls are implemented to reduce the risk to as low as reasonably practicable.
  • Participate in internal/external HSE audits and ensure assurance inspections are completed in accordance with the schedule.
  • Incident and Injury Management in accordance with corporate and client requirements.
  • Support the implementation of the Assist and Assure Program on the project.
  • Monitor and manage compliance with MPK and Client HSE policies, procedures, directives, and standards.
  • Develop and implement strategies to continually improving the safety culture and performance of the project to achieve an incident free workplace.
  • Monitor project HSE Performance against corporate and project KPI's, communicating the outcome and implementing improvement plans as required.
  • Advise, coach and mentor project staff (including subcontractors) on Risk Management and HSE Continuous Improvement.
  • Ensure all internal, client and legislative reporting requirements are met.
  • Manage and coordinate project training including training records.

Skills and Experiences:

About you:


Minimum 10 years' experience within the Health, Safety and Environmental field at a site management level in the construction and gas industries.


Mandatory qualifications:

  • Formal Qualifications in OHS/ WHS (Min Diploma in OHS/WHS)
  • Certificate IV Training and Assessment (TAE40110 or equivalent)
  • ICAM Lead Incident Investigation
  • Provide First Aid with Provide cardiopulmonary resuscitation (HLTAID003 / HLTAID001)
  • Coal Seam Gas Industry Safety Induction (ISI)
  • Drug and Alcohol Testing (HLTPAT005 or equivalent)
  • 4WD Operate and maintain/ 4WD Operate vehicles in the field (PMASUP236/ RIIVEH305E)
  • Chain of Responsibility (COR)
  • General Construction Induction (White Card)
  • CPCCWHS100
  • Driver's License Open C Class

Desired qualifications:

  • Formal Qualifications in Environmental Management (Min Cert IV in Environmental Management)
  • Lead Auditor
  • Workplace Rehabilitation and Return to Work Coordinator (Queensland Workers Compensation Regulator approved training course).
